Iran, Germany to co-op in preserving Tabriz cultural heritage

Tabriz, East Azarbaijan Prov., Nov 2, IRNA – The Managing Director of East Azarbaijan Cultural Heritage, Handicrafts and Tourism said Iran and Germany will cooperate in protecting Tabriz cultural heritage. Speaking in the opening ceremony of the 1st Irano-German International Symposium on Archaeometry, Morteza Abdar told IRNA that Tabriz cultural heritage is both nationally and internationally valuable. Due to its various potentials, Tabriz was selected by the Organization of Islamic Cooperation (OIC) as the tourism capital of the Islamic world in 2018, he added. He said that regarding the academic infrastructure of Tabriz Islamic Art University, it turned out to be Iran's archeometry hub and it is regarded as one of the most important centers in protection of cultural heritage and as a partner it takes part in academic activities with East Azarbaijan Cultural Heritage, Handicrafts and Tourism office. The 1st Irano-German International Symposium on Archaeometry is underway in Tabriz Islamic Art University until November 4. 1378/IRNA
